Party Round Raises $7M in Funding

  • Party Round, a US startup that builds fundraising tools for founders, raised $7M in funding
  • The round was led by Andreesen Horowitz and Andreessen Horowitz Cultural Leadership Fund, with participation from Seven Seven Six, Abstract Ventures, and Shrug Capital
  • The company intends to use the funds to expand operations and its business reach
  • Led by CEO Jordi Hays, PartyRound is building a software platform that eases the process of raising early-stage corporate capital
  • The tool enables founders to automate the raising process (from open to close), send docs, collect signatures, and receive funds
  • It is a remote-first company but frequently spend time IRL in California and New York. Party Round currently has a team of 10 people
